Fold compares irrespective of whether allocation can be elided
Summary When a non-escaping pointer is compared to a global value, the comparison can be folded even if the corresponding malloc/allocation call cannot be elided. We need to make sure the global value is not null, since comparisons to null cannot be folded. In future, we should also handle cases when the the comparison instruction dominates the pointer escape.
